The Pacific Public Health Training Center (PPHTC) is one of 14 HRSA-funded centers throughout the U.S. that were established to provide training to the public health workforce. Click on any of the other centers listed below to view their training activities.

The PPHTC is funded through a grant from the Health Resources and Services Administration (HRSA) of the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services. To improve the Nation's public health system by strengthening the technical, scientific, mangerial, and leadership skills and abilities of current and future public health professionals.
